How to relieve soreness and pain in the scapular suture

Scapular suture pain is mainly related to local soft tissue fatigue, cold, damage, usually for general treatment, drug therapy to relieve. If the pain symptoms cannot be relieved, it is necessary to go to the hospital to take X-rays, MRI, etc. for clear diagnosis, and if necessary, surgery is feasible.1. General treatment: If you find scapular suture soreness and pain, try to brake and rest, including reducing the shoulder joint activities, especially in the acute attack stage of the disease, the pain is more intense, so you should reduce the activities appropriately and let the local area fully rest. If the pain and soreness of the scapular joint is common, you should pay attention to avoid getting cold, add clothes according to the weather, and avoid exposing your upper arm at night when you sleep. At the same time, you should move your shoulder joints in moderation to avoid overworking the muscles around the scapula.
